Signal Mountain Campground offers a beautiful and well-maintained setting right next to Jackson Lake, with clean facilities, running water, and a variety of amenities, including boat rentals and dining options. Campers appreciate the wildlife, privacy of sites, and great views, although some sites have limited lake visibility and issues with electrical service. While the campground is popular and can be pricey, many visitors express a desire to return due to the serene atmosphere and access to nature.

We camped in our 24 foot motorhome on the last available camping day of the season. The weather was beautiful, nighttime temps in the high 20’s, and overall the campground was quiet. Spent the day visiting Yellowstone highlights, and camped in West Yellowstone the following evening.

We loved our stay at the campground, and the hosts were extremely helpful. This site is sandwiched in between two other sites, but it does have extra parking space because of it. This site has a glimpse of the lake which is beautiful, but having to walk through another site in order to get to your vehicle was awkward. Plenty of space for a large, family size tent with play room still all around.
